Modeling of Pollutant Dispersion from a Moving Source
Application to Airport Pollution

Abstract

The atmospheric dispersion process of pollutants emitted from a moving aircraft is represented by a puff diffusion model to simulate its movements precisely near the airport, under the assumption of a Gaussian distribution function. Three-dimensional diffusion parameters are estimated by matching calculated concentrations to those measured in the field with tracer experiments. By using these parameters, the time-dependent ground level concentrations of CO and NOx and the isopleths of NOx for quasi-static takeoff operations of aircraft are presented.
